ALLENTOWN, Pa. – Allentown police say a Burger King worker was found with a stab wound to the throat when officers responded to the restaurant Saturday night.

According to a news release from the Allentown Police Department, officers found the victim after being called to the restaurant at 1958 South Fourth Street around 6:14 p.m.

Officers immediately rendered first aid, and the victim was taken to Lehigh Valley Cedar Crest hospital.

Police were able to locate the suspect, 18-year-old Brinley Capellan-Lopez, who is also a Burger King employee.

Brinley Capellan-Lopez of Allentown has been charged with attempted homicide, aggravated assault with a deadly weapon, and aggravated assault.

In addition to the charges related to the Burger King incident, Capellan-Lopez was recently charged with obstruction of justice in a shooting near William Allen High School on May 21, 2025.
